- The distance between Amite, La, Usa and Acajutla, El Salvador is approximately 1,908 km or 1,186 mi.
- To reach Amite, La in this distance one would set out from Acajutla bearing 358°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Amite, La bearing 357.8° or N .
- Amite, La has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Acajutla has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
- Both are in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The average annual temperature is 7.6 °C (13.7°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 15.6 °C (28.1°F) more in Amite, La.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 108.1 mm (4.3 in) less which is equivalent to 108.1 l/m² (2.65 US gal/ft²) or 1,081,000 l/ha (115,566 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 13.1° lower in Amite, La than in Acajutla.
